#7f69c9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7f69c9 is composed of 49.8% red, 41.2% green and 78.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 36.8% cyan, 47.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 21.2% black. It has a hue angle of 253.8 degrees, a saturation of 47.1% and a lightness of 60%. #7f69c9 color hex could be obtained by blending #fed2ff with #000093.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

#7f69c9 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#7f69c9 has RGB values of R:127, G:105, B:201 and CMYK values of C:0.37, M:0.48, Y:0, K:0.21. Its decimal value is 8350153.

Hex triplet 7f69c9 #7f69c9
RGB Decimal 127, 105, 201 rgb(127,105,201)
RGB Percent 49.8, 41.2, 78.8 rgb(49.8%,41.2%,78.8%)
CMYK 37, 48, 0, 21
HSL 253.8°, 47.1, 60 hsl(253.8,47.1%,60%)
HSV (or HSB) 253.8°, 47.8, 78.8
Web Safe 6666cc #6666cc
CIE-LAB 50.49, 30.94, -47.121
XYZ 24.345, 18.832, 57.607
xyY 0.242, 0.187, 18.832
CIE-LCH 50.49, 56.371, 303.289
CIE-LUV 50.49, 3.401, -75.467
Hunter-Lab 43.396, 24.194, -48.33
Binary 01111111, 01101001, 11001001

Shades and Tints of #7f69c9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040309 is the darkest color, while #faf9fd is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#7f69c9 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#7b7b7b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#7c778b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#517cd5 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#4e7fc6 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#73818a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#6275d0 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#6077c7 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#7778a1 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
